Great stay. We didn't realize it was actually at a hotel type resort which turned out to be quite pleasant. The pool was a nice touch along with outdoor showers to rinse off after returning from surfing at a private beach right across the street. The room itself was sparsely decorated with nothing in the kitchen for basics like salt/pepper/paper towels/cooking oil. There are a couple restaurants in the area with one quite good right next door. We really enjoyed our stay but disappointed with the surf rentals. They only had soft top rentals which were in very poor shape and there were no other other options within walking distance despite being told there are two surf shops close. If you do go to surf and need to rent, rent in town at Frijoles or another shop. One shout out, we did leave a valuable ring in the room when we checked out. We called on our way back and one of the managers retrieved it for us which was a huge relief and sign of class. We would return again.

We had a lovely stay at Javier's. The apartment was very clean and comfortable, which we especially appreciated after our long trip from California. Best thing for us was how close the beach was. It took us less than five minutes to walk to a stunningly gorgeous beach with the best body surfing waves we've ever caught. There were also some nice places to eat nearby and an easy jaunt to the water taxi's which take you to Tamarindo. Day trips are also very doable, with the Las Leonas waterfalls within a 1.5 hr drive and the Buena Vista adventure tours (zip lining, horseback, water slide) within 2.5 hrs. Would definitely stay here again.

Hotel Manglar is the perfect location for couples or small families looking for a relaxed space just off the beach. We were there to surf and surf we did. You can book boards and lessons from the hotel and the beach is walking distance to the perfect break for learning to surf. Amazing restaurants, highly recommend El Huerto, Hotel Cantentera and Café Mar Azul, but honestly everywhere we ate the food was delicious. You can book excursions to nearby beaches, estuary tour or Viejo Rincon or just relax on the beach. We will be back for sure!
